    General Statement:
    The Connecticut State Board of Education (CSBE) believes that high-quality, comprehensive and effective English as a Second Language (ESL) and bilingual education programs are essential to acquire English language proficiency and academic proficiency for students who are English Learners (ELs). Bilingual teachers work under Section 10 17e(2) of the C.G.S. This statute defines bilingual education as a program that: “(A) Makes instructional use of both English and the eligible student’s native language (B) enables eligible students to achieve English proficiency and academic mastery of subject matter and higher order skills, including critical thinking, so as to meet appropriate grade promotion and graduation requirements; (C) provides for the continuous increase in the use of English and corresponding decrease in the use of the native language for the purpose of instruction within each year and from year to year and provides for the use of English for more than half of the instructional time by the end of the first year.”

    Bilingual teachers are bilingual certified instructors who teach individuals who are bilingual eligible and have selected the bilingual program. Bilingual teachers work with eligible students to provide grade level appropriate content with linguistic and academic supports. The goal of the bilingual program is to provide Spanish or Haitian-Creole language support as a scaffold for students in order to make the core curriculum comprehensible for ELs while building language proficiency in English.

    Educational programs for ELs are regulated by the Every Student Succeeds Act, Title I and Title III. The Bilingual teacher is a part of the Stamford Public Schools EL Department. The Bilingual teacher receives supervision from building administration and technical supervision and assistance from the Coordinator of English Learners (EL).

    Qualifications:

    • CT CSDE certification endorsed for Bilingual Education as appropriate for the content area and grade levels:
      • Bilingual, Pre-K – Grade 12 (009)
      • Bilingual Elementary Education, Pre-K – Grade 8 (902)
      • Bilingual English, Middle School (966) or Bilingual English, Grades 7-12 (915)
      • Bilingual Mathematics, Middle School (968) or Bilingual Mathematics, Grades 7-12 (929)
      • Bilingual History/Social Studies, Middle School (967) or Bilingual History/Social Studies, Grades 7-12 (926)
      • Bilingual Biology, Middle School (969), Bilingual Chemistry, Middle School (970), Bilingual Physics, Middle School (971), Bilingual Earth Science, Middle School (972), Bilingual General Science, Middle School (973), or Bilingual Integrated Science, Middle School (974)
      • Bilingual Biology, Grades 7-12 (930) AND Bilingual Chemistry, Grades 7-12 (931) or Bilingual Physics, Grades 7-12 (932) or Bilingual Earth Science, Grades 7-12 (933) or Bilingual General Science, Grades 7-12 (934)
